The original artwork was held in the Dulwich Gallery in London, England. Bartolome Esteban Murillo Bartolome Esteban Murillo (1617 1682) was a native of Seville, Spain. He was most recognized for his religious paintings. Murillo studied under Juan del Castillo, as well as Velasquez. Later, Murillo served as president of the Seville Academy
